Currency Analysis: Sei (SEI)

As a specialized parallelized EVM Layer 1 chain designed for high-speed trading and Orderbook matching optimization, Sei (SEI) is currently trading around approximately $0.039 to $0.041. The asset is building a low-level base and allowing capital to consolidate.

* Cycle stage: In the process of reorganizing low-tier holdings after long-term deleveraging; it is now expanding ecosystem applications following the rollout of the Sei v2 architecture, along with a period of token unlock digestion.
* Support and resistance: The key technical support zone below lies at $0.035 to $0.038. The main swing resistance levels above are expected at $0.048 to $0.055.
* Market perspective:
* Parallelized EVM and dual-engine optimization: Sei delivers high throughput and extremely low latency (sub-second finality) through EVM parallelization. This has attracted a large number of native DEXs, derivatives protocols, and on-chain high-frequency trading strategies, making it a highly trade-oriented infrastructure moat.
* Token circulation release pressure and altcoin liquidity tightening: As periodic investor holdings and ecosystem incentive tokens gradually unlock and are released, the market needs time to absorb the increased circulating supply. In addition, with capital in the current crypto market highly concentrated in BTC, spot price action is temporarily following the broader market’s consolidation from lower levels, building momentum.
